hi!

scsi gurus please help! today my kernel barked like:

Oct 11 15:05:07 terix kernel: Recovery code sleeping
Oct 11 15:05:07 terix kernel: (scsi0:A:3:0): Abort Tag Message Sent
Oct 11 15:05:07 terix kernel: (scsi0:A:3:0): SCB 116 - Abort Tag Completed.
Oct 11 15:05:07 terix kernel: Recovery SCB completes
Oct 11 15:05:07 terix kernel: Recovery code awake
Oct 11 15:05:07 terix kernel: aic7xxx_abort returns 8194
Oct 11 15:05:07 terix kernel: scsi0:0:3:0: Attempting to queue an ABORT message
Oct 11 15:05:07 terix kernel: (scsi0:A:3:0): Queuing a recovery SCB
Oct 11 15:05:07 terix kernel: scsi0:0:3:0: Device is disconnected, re-queuing SCB
Oct 11 15:05:07 terix kernel: Recovery code sleeping
Oct 11 15:05:07 terix kernel: (scsi0:A:3:0): Abort Tag Message Sent
Oct 11 15:05:07 terix kernel: (scsi0:A:3:0): SCB 107 - Abort Tag Completed.
Oct 11 15:05:07 terix kernel: Recovery SCB completes
Oct 11 15:05:07 terix kernel: Recovery code awake
Oct 11 15:05:07 terix kernel: aic7xxx_abort returns 8194
Oct 11 15:05:07 terix kernel: scsi0:0:3:0: Attempting to queue an ABORT message
Oct 11 15:05:07 terix kernel: (scsi0:A:3:0): Queuing a recovery SCB
Oct 11 15:05:07 terix kernel: scsi0:0:3:0: Device is disconnected, re-queuing SCB

and the machine froze for a couple of minutes. in short I have
a Tyan motherbaord with Athlon SMP support and ADAPTEC SCSI onboard, 
kernel version :

2.4.10-xfs #1 SMP Wed Sep 26 09:44:28 CEST 2001 i686 unknown

I attach some more descriptive dumps of my config from kern.log.
(pls. don't tell me my hdd is broken; this would be the third
one I change in only ONE month)

On Thu, Oct 11, 2001 at 04:06:28PM +0200, Cristian CONSTANTIN wrote:

Same problem appeared here, seems to be a faulty firmware of my Quantum drive. As you have a IBM drive look for firmware upgrades, maybe it helps :) Also try a boot with aic7xxx=verbose as a kernel-parameter.
